Storyline

The background is in the distant future after the destruction brought about by Armageddon. The war between the vampires and the humans continue to persist. In order to protect the humans from the vampires, Vatican has to rely on other allies to counter the situation. The protagonist, a priest called Peter Abel Nightroad, travels through the countries as a representative for the Vaticans. However, he is also part of "Ax", a special operations group controlled by the Cardinal Catherina. His encounter with a young girl called Esther will determine the struggle and survival between the human race and the vampires. Written by md

Did You Know?

Trivia

The race of vampires is known as Methuselahs. In the Bible, Methuselah was famous for his long life (he lived to be 969 years old); this alludes to the vampires' longevity. See more »
